Visible light passes through a diffraction grating that has 900 slits per centimeter, and the interference pattern is observed on a screen that is 2.30 m from the grating. In the first-order spectrum, maxima for two different wavelengths are separated on the screen by 2.96 mm. What is the difference betwoen these wavelengths? Express your answer in meters.
